Plugin authors targeting the Quillforge analyzer must regenerate the baseline file whenever a new rule category ships. Run the baseline task from a clean checkout; a dirty working tree will fold unrelated findings into the snapshot and mask genuine regressions. Commit the resulting file alongside your plugin manifest so the Quillforge CI gate can diff against it. The baseline tooling also records suppression counts in the audit store, and it needs read-write access to reach it. Connect using the following string.

primary connection of tawif-yajeg = postgresql://rusiel_svc:G879q9cx6GsSvj@db-dd9f.norvagrid.internal:5432/casath

Subject: Orchard Tracker — slipping again

Hi all — quick heads-up for the sales leads before the exec sync. The Orchard Tracker rollout at Dunmore Analytics is pushing out another six weeks. The integration team hit snags with the old Casterline database, and testing hasn't started. I know several of you promised demos this quarter; please hold those until we confirm a new date. Apologies for the churn. The reasoning behind our revised priorities is noted confidentially below.

board note of kageg-bahof: The renewal with Holwynax Holdings closes at $2 million a year, 5 percent below the last contract. Project Ulaath slips by two quarters because of the supplier delay.

- [ ] **Step 7: Breaker override escrow.** After sealing the signing keys for the Tallgrove upstream API circuit breaker, confirm the support team can force the breaker open during a full outage. The override bundle lives in the sealed escrow drawer and is useless without its unlock phrase. Two ceremony witnesses must initial this step before proceeding. The escrow bundle is decrypted with the recovery passphrase that follows.

vault phrase of kahip-kahop = holath-quenmir

### Runbook: Report export timezone mismatches (Glimmerfield)

If a customer reports that exported totals differ from the dashboard, check whether their report schedule predates the March cutover — older schedules still render in server-local time rather than the account timezone. Re-saving the schedule fixes it. Before escalating, confirm the export worker is running with the expected timezone settings shown below.

config for kadup-kajog:
[raldor]
host = raldor.tolvaqworks.internal
user = raldor_svc
database = raldor_prod